The bicyclist who was killed in a hit-and-run in Hunt's Point has been identified.
Police say 31-year-old Dilmania Lopez de Rodriguez was riding her bicycle after midnight and attempting to cross Bruckner Boulevard. She was struck by a car making a right turn from Leggett Avenue. EMS transported her to NYC Health + Hospitals/Lincoln and pronounced deceased.
Meanwhile, the car that struck her did not remain on scene.
The investigation is ongoing by the NYPD Highway District's Collision Investigation Squad.
